Comprehending Physics Calculators


Physics calculators are specialized estimation tools created to carry out calculations particular to physics. Unlike Infinity Calculator , which handle standard arithmetic or innovative functions like graphing, physics calculators can deal with complicated formulas related to different physics fields. Here are some significant kinds of physics calculators:

Types of Physics Calculators

Type

Description

Examples

Standard Calculator

Handles easy physics formulas and math.

Requirement clinical calculators (e.g., Casio FX-991EX)

Scientific Calculator

Appropriate for performing more complex estimations involving trigonometric functions, logarithms, and exponentials.

Texas Instruments TI-36X Pro

Graphing Calculator

Efficient in outlining charts for envisioning functions and formulas. Useful for physics principles like movement.

TI-84 Plus CE, HP Prime

Online Physics Calculators

Web-based tools that permit fast computations without requiring software application setup.

PhysicsCalculator.com, RapidTables.com

Specialized Software

Software application particularly developed for mimicing physical systems or performing innovative physics estimations.

MATLAB, Mathematica

Vital Features of Physics Calculators


When choosing a physics calculator, numerous functions can considerably boost the use and efficiency of the tool. Here are crucial functions to think about:

  1. User Interface

    • A clear, instinctive interface simplifies operation, especially throughout tests or time-sensitive circumstances.
  2. Built-in Functions

    • Lots of physics calculators have built-in functions for common physics computations, such as kinematics formulas, electrical field computations, or thermodynamics functions.
  3. Memory Functions

    • The ability to shop and retrieve previous estimations permits users to build on past results without restarting from scratch.
  4. Graphing Capabilities

    • For principles requiring visual analysis, graphing functions can outline formulas dynamically and aid in understanding relationships between variables.
  5. Unit Conversions

    • Built-in unit conversion functions help ensure that computations are brought out regularly across various measurement systems.
  6. Assistance for Equations and Formulas

    • Advanced calculators typically feature a library of formulas and constants needed for numerous physics fields.
